FERVENT PRAYERS

James 5:13-18
DEVOTIONAL: “Confess your trespasses to one another, and pray for one another, that you may be healed. The effective, fervent prayer of a righteous man avails much” (Vs. 16).

 If God will always answer our prayers, then we must also understand the place of fervency in prayers. To be fervent is to be strongly focused on God and stay connected to the purpose of our prayers. It is displaying a passionate intensity on our prayer lives. For us to be fervent in our prayer lives, we must learn to go to God with a purpose and determined heart to receive from Him. When we connect with God in the attitude of faith, He would be attracted to us. 
  As much as people have needs, some still come to God with a 50/50 devotion. A fervent prayer comes from a strong heart built strong by faith in the word of God. Isaac prayed with fervency for his wife to conceive (Genesis 25:21). Hannah prayed with fervency and she received Samuel (1 Samuel 1:27). You and I can always receive whatever we need if only we learn to pray fervently. Instead of our challenges weighing us down, let us come boldly in faith and with the determination of not taking “No” for an answer. As we do this, heaven will be opened for us and we shall have testimonies.

Prayer: Lord, it is time for my prayers to be answered in Jesus name.
